BOY’S SKULL FRACTURED

FALL FROM CYCLE SERIOUS CONDITION OF VICTIM | (From Our Own Correspondent) HAMILTON, To-day. Serious injuries were received by Lawrence Mitchell, aged li. of 7 Von Tempsky Street, Hamilton, about 10.30 n-<lwy. The boy was riding his bicycle near the Catholic Church when the machine skidded, throwing him heavily. He was taken to the "VVaikato Hospital suffering from a fracture at the base of his skull. His condition is regarded as serious.
